1. Flooring Materials and Options

The choice of flooring material significantly impacts the appearance, durability, and maintenance requirements of a room. Consider factors such as foot traffic, moisture resistance, style preferences, and budget. Popular flooring options include hardwood, laminate, tile, vinyl, and carpet. Each material offers unique properties and considerations, so thorough research is essential to determine the best fit for individual needs.

2. Kitchen Cabinet Design and Functionality

Kitchen cabinets serve both aesthetic and functional purposes. They provide storage, enhance the room's style, and can improve workflow efficiency. Plan the cabinet layout carefully, considering the location of appliances, the height and reach of occupants, and the amount of storage required. Explore various cabinet styles, materials, and finishes to match the overall kitchen design.

3. Underlayment and Subflooring Preparation

Proper preparation of the subflooring and underlayment ensures a stable and durable foundation for the flooring. Assess the existing subfloor for any irregularities or damage that may need repair. Choose an appropriate underlayment based on the flooring material to provide support, sound dampening, and moisture resistance.

4. Cabinet Installation Techniques

Installing kitchen cabinets requires precision and attention to detail. Determine the layout and mark the wall locations accurately. Use levelers and spacers to ensure proper alignment and ensure all cabinets are securely fastened. Utilize brackets or supports for added stability, especially in areas with heavy loads.

5. Flooring Installation Methods

Flooring installation methods vary depending on the material chosen. Follow the manufacturer's instructions carefully to ensure proper installation and longevity. For example, hardwood flooring requires nailing or stapling into place, while tile flooring involves the use of thin-set adhesive and grout. Ensure the room is properly prepared, including moisture barriers and transition strips.
